Transaction c63dd7504c94684349f510171344d2558132cb64af6651ab636ea842e381df58
1 Input
1 Output
-
c63dd7504c94684349f510171344d2558132cb64af6651ab636ea842e381df58:0
- value
- 100591
- script pubkey
- OP_0 OP_PUSHBYTES_20 ecd31304a4ee25779d457b4f474d589fec329715
- address
- bc1qanf3xp9yacjh08290d85wn2cnlkr99c4crvddx